This weeks featured artist is Kelly Wilson (vocal soprano)

Kelly is delighted to be working on this concert with such talented people from around the country.   Kelly says “One of my earliest and best memories of performance is going to a nursing home with my grandfather, Mr Rod Wilson. We entertained the residents for a time, then my grandfather announced that it was my seventh birthday. Everyone was happy and smiling; that was when I decided I never wanted to stop singing. I promised I would keep bringing those smiles to people’s faces.

Since then I’ve performed many times as a soloist and as part of a choir, including singing with the Bella Voce choir at ANZAC Day celebrations and competing in the Australian Vocal and Concerto Competition.

I’ve also thoroughly enjoyed being a part of several local theatre productions, the most recent of which were NQOMT’s “The Phantom of the Opera” and “Hello Dolly”.

I have been studying with Susan Grinsell for more than a decade and have now moved into teaching myself. Currently, I am teaching song and dance classes at Ann Roberts School of Dance. I hope I can instill in some of my students the same love of music that my wonderful teachers and mentors have given me.”
